I am finishing a Shire Scenes Siphon C kit. In the kit instructions and on the GWR modelling website the model is shown with 3 gas lamp tops on the roof centered with each door. However a diagram from the Slinn book on GWR siphons shows these with only 2 gas lamp tops. Unfortunately the Slinn book is going for $167 in paper back which is more than I am interested in paying, so I hope someone reading this post has a copy or can answer my question. Were there multiple diagrams showing 2 and 3 lamp tops, or did the GWR add a third lamp at some point?  Here is  copy of the diagram in question.

i have the slinden book, and it only says "Incandescent gas lighting , with roof pipes, was fitted from new to those om Lots 1133 and 1162 and to the remainder in 8/09.

The only picture i can find showing the roof is on page 34 of Wild Swan Publications book of the Calne Branch by Colin G Maggs . it shows only 2 lamps.

There were two diagrams for the Siphon C: the 8'-wide O8 and the 8'6"-wide O9. I haven't got my reference books handy at the moment, but it is likely the differences in the lamp tops are because of the different diagrams.

Yes, if you read the fine print at the bottom of the scan it says that the drawing shown is diagram 0.8 and there is a second 0.9 with minor differences described in the text. I suspect the gas tops are among those minor differences.

 

By the way this is a nice kit that goes together quote easily. Be aware that the lamp irons mentioned in the instructions are actually not included in the etchings but I was able to make them using the flat etched hand grabs with just a couple of bends. The most tedious part is installing all those small etched details. I broke the job up by installing small batches over a couple pf days which avoided the eye strain. I went off the diagram in the book rather than the instructions and put 2 lamp tops on mine. I was thinking that perhaps they had misconstrued the destination board brackets as lamp tops on the kit instructions. There's no mention in the book of any differences in them wrt to the lighting. Also given the kit is 32mm wide, that puts it in the O8 camp to me and thus matching the diagram in Slinn et all.

Hi Larry, there is no elevation of the roof in the book, just the side and end. There's a few pictures but the roof detail is either obscured or later in life when the lamps had been removed. Since I'm modelling mid-late 1930s, I probably shouldn't even have had them on! I skipped any piping due to lack of info on it.
